How to Decide

NetBeans is a free, open‑source IDE that’s especially popular among Java developers and students looking for a no‑cost desktop development environment. The alternatives split into a few clear camps: code‑server leans on a self‑hosted, browser‑based VS Code experience that lets any VS Code extension run remotely; Eclipse emphasizes a modular plugin architecture with a visual UI designer for SWT/JavaFX and built‑in Maven/Gradle support; IntelliJ IDEA is chosen for its deep, language‑specific intelligence and freemium pricing that unlocks advanced features for professional Java/Kotlin work; Visual Studio Code stands out with its massive extension marketplace and first‑class remote‑development capabilities for containers, WSL and SSH.

When comparing these options to NetBeans, focus on (1) the licensing and pricing model – pure free/open‑source versus freemium or subscription‑based tiers; (2) deployment and access – desktop‑only apps versus self‑hosted web IDEs or remote‑development support; (3) breadth and depth of the extension/plugin ecosystem, which affects language coverage and tooling integration; and (4) UI/UX modernity and performance characteristics, especially how each IDE handles large projects and resource usage.
